From: Ryan Lortie Date: Tue, 24 Aug 2010 17:25:43 +0000 (+0200) Subject: MemberAccess: Fix crash in .to_string() X-Git-Tag: 0.11.0~91 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=a3471783900f0cc8568d09ec45abb99183f56ae3;p=thirdparty%2Fvala.git MemberAccess: Fix crash in .to_string() MemberAccess.to_string() would crash if it was run before the symbol resolver. Fix that. --- diff --git a/vala/valamemberaccess.vala b/vala/valamemberaccess.vala index 443e67b4d..6548fc599 100644 --- a/vala/valamemberaccess.vala +++ b/vala/valamemberaccess.vala @@ -132,7 +132,7 @@ public class Vala.MemberAccess : Expression { } public override string to_string () { - if (symbol_reference.is_instance_member ()) { + if (symbol_reference == null || symbol_reference.is_instance_member ()) { if (inner == null) { return member_name; } else {